A Saudi Arabian tourist caught driving between 130km/h and 140km/h near Te Anau told a judge that he was not aware what the speed limit was.
Eiad Abdelmohsen Alfares, 51, professor and practising doctor, appeared in Invercargill District Court charged with driving dangerously on July 17, the Southland Times, reported.
